Diagnosing Fibromyalgia: Tests Your Doctor Should Run in the Course of Your Treatment

[ad_1] Fibromyalgia is often missed or misdiagnosed for a number of reasons. There aren’t definitive blood tests or X-ray to diagnose Fibromyalgia and it shares symptoms with many other diseases and conditions. Alternative Medicine Treatment of Plantar Fasciitis

[ad_1] Plantar fasciitis (PF) affects approximately two-million people in the US, of both athletic and non-athletic populations. This condition can be debilitating and significantly affect one’s quality of life in a very negative way. There are few high quality studies on this condition and the most successful treatments.
